Quick and Easy VAL Board Install

Get static IP address, data mod extension, subnet, Gateway, and network name of the VAL board from the customer.


IP Address _____________________________
Data Mod Ext _____________________________
Subnet _____________________________
Gateway _____________________________
VAL Board Name _____________________________

1. Insert VAL board into empty slot and put black IP Media Adapter (possibly in a little white box inside VAL board carton) on the corresponding slot/amphenol connector on the back of cabinet.
2. Let board settle. (no lights on board) [3 to 5 minutes]
3. Do æcha node-n iÆ
A. Name board: i.e. VAL#1, VAL#2, or what the customer wants.
B. Enter IP address.
4. Do æcha ip-iÆ
DonÆt enable until you reach the end of the page!
A. For Type enter æVALÆ.
B. Enter slot number where VAL was
installed: i.e. 01D11.
C. Enter name from step 3-A.
D. Enter Subnet.
E. Enter Gateway.
F. Enter Network Region æ1Æ unless
told otherwise.
5. Do ædisp comm liÆ
A. Write down next unused link for next
step. ___________
6. Do æadd data nextÆ
A. For Type enter æethernetÆ.
B. For Port enter VAL board location plus æ33Æ
for port: i.e. 01D1133
C. Under Link put in the link number from 5-A.
D. Under Name put in name from 3-A.
7. Plug in ethernet cable to adapter that you should
have put on the back of the Definity.
8. Do æcha ip-iÆ and put Enable to æyÆ. Do not enable
if there is no ethernet connection.
9. Do æsa tÆ.
10. Do ædisp alaÆ to check VAL board for alarms and
resolve if any.
11. Job complete. You may install Voice Announcement
Over LAN software.

It is somewhat different for MV or CM. But if you understand this, you will be able to figure it out in the new loads.
